The Role of Technology in IIIT Quant Education

Technology is undeniably the bedrock of any modern quantitative finance program, and IIITs are leveraging it to the fullest. When we talk about IIIT Quant news, the integration of advanced technological tools and platforms is a constant theme. Students are trained not just in theory but also in the practical application of software and hardware essential for quant roles. This includes programming languages like Python (with libraries like NumPy, Pandas, and Scikit-learn), R, C++, and Java, which are the workhorses of quantitative analysis. Beyond programming, there's a heavy emphasis on databases, cloud computing platforms (like AWS, Azure, GCP), and data visualization tools (like Tableau or Power BI) to handle and interpret vast amounts of financial data. Furthermore, many programs now incorporate exposure to specialized financial software and platforms used in the industry, such as Bloomberg Terminals, Refinitiv Eikon, and various risk management systems. The goal is to ensure that when graduates enter the workforce, they are not just familiar with these tools but proficient in using them to solve complex financial problems. This technological fluency is a key differentiator for IIIT Quant graduates, setting them apart in a competitive job market. The continuous evolution of technology means that IIITs must constantly update their labs and curriculum to reflect the latest industry trends, which is precisely what makes IIIT Quant news so dynamic and important to follow.

Think about the power of high-performance computing (HPC) and cloud-based analytics. These technologies allow for the processing of massive datasets and the execution of complex simulations in fractions of the time it would take using traditional methods. IIITs are increasingly incorporating these into their curriculum, teaching students how to harness the power of distributed computing for tasks like portfolio optimization, risk modeling, and algorithmic strategy backtesting. The accessibility of cloud platforms also democratizes access to powerful computing resources, enabling students to work on sophisticated projects without needing massive on-premise infrastructure. Finally, the growth of ESG (Environmental, Social, and Governance) investing presents a new frontier for quantitative finance. Investors are increasingly looking beyond traditional financial metrics to consider a company's sustainability and ethical practices. This creates a demand for quantitative analysts who can develop models to assess ESG risks and opportunities, integrate ESG factors into investment strategies, and measure the impact of sustainable investments. IIITs are beginning to recognize this trend, with some programs exploring specialized courses or research opportunities in sustainable finance and quantitative ESG analysis. This represents a significant opportunity for graduates to contribute to a more responsible and sustainable financial system while pursuing lucrative and impactful careers. The intersection of finance, data, and sustainability is a rapidly expanding field, and IIIT Quant programs are poised to play a crucial role in shaping its future.
